This is because some of the screensavers use 3d functionality, and access to the /dev/nvidia* devices is required for that functionality. The more proper solution is to add users to the video group (just like you do with sound, disk, whatever the case may be).
In my installation they get permissions 660 and owner root:video which makes them unusable for a normal user (non root). I'v changed my udev-setup by giving everybody rw-access to these devices. But, this is not needed for X to run. Only for the screensaver in KDE (which is build upon xscreensaver) strange enough.
